影响机械臂遥操作的认知功能分析

         

摘要

Identification of the cognitive function and study of the cognitive behaviorin teleoperation are conducive to perform the teleoperation task successfully and set up the human reliability analysis system in space teleoperation. The relationship between situation awareness, space transformation a⁃bility, perception and teleoperation process was analyzed according to the previous researches. The influence of various cognitive functions in various stages of operation process was studied based on the specific teleoperation task. NASA training assessment metric was studied and classified accord⁃ing to situation awareness, space transformation ability and perception. Furthermore, some tips a⁃bout future study of space teleoperation from the cognitive level were proposed and the future study of space teleoperation from visual information representation, cognitive function change and human er⁃ror prediction was prospected.%研究遥操作过程涉及到的认知行为,识别影响遥操作任务绩效的认知功能,有助于建立空间遥操作的人因可靠性分析体系,并保障在轨遥操作任务顺利完成。结合国内外研究,着重分析遥操作与情境意识、空间转换、感知觉三者之间的关系,并结合具体遥操作任务剖析各项认知功能在操作过程各个阶段的影响作用;针对情境意识、空间转换、感知觉等认知功能对NASA的机械臂遥操作训练指标进行分类梳理;最后提出了未来从认知层面开展空间遥操作研究时应该注意的问题,并从视觉信息呈现、认知功能变化和人为失误预测等方向对未来遥操作研究进行展望。
